What I Get/What I Want

I receive about five emails a month from [email protected], most with alerts of expiring Challenges, some with Top Stories and links to people to which I subscribe, a few have platform updates.
Let me restate that last bit: not just a 'dew' or a 'very few': within the past twelve months I've received exactly TWO platform updates. I know because I am a Gen Jones/Boomer and I carefully save my emails from Vocal in case I need them. As one save the boxes from Apple because they feel good and are a 'very nice box'. Now that I have found a need to consult how many emails I receive from Vocal I will, likely, never delete them at all.
On July 7 I received an email titled A New Vocal: A Rebuilt Editor, Verified Publishing, and a More Human Platform. It contained a link to Justin's post of the same title.
The email had a few bullet points: Editor, Verifying, and the news that earned would now be only for Vocal+ members.
The content from Justin went into more detail, adding that now connecting to Stripe is required to publish on the platform, and again with the news of earnings for only Vocal+ members towards the end of the piece.
This is the first non-story related email I've received from Vocal for... a long time.
(I checked- the last time was twice on October 21 2025, when access was blocked due to the AWS Great Outage. Before that it was October 2, 2024 when the ability to Edit, Revert to Draft, and Delete was granted to Vocal+ members. Given that we are now working through the IN-ability to edit, perhaps I shouldn't have mentioned this...)
The next day, July 8, I received an email titled Update to our terms and policies . (Yes, most of the title was in lowercase, and yes that left me unsettled after years of capitalized words in the email title and Vocal post subtitles...). A link to the usual Policy tab on the Resources section of Vocal was included.
Although the seven resources on this tab each look between 4 and 7 years old, all of them except the AI Policy were updated in July 2026. If you haven't read these policies before, or even if it's been a while since you first read them, take a few minutes to read them now. Note that Comments have been disabled for the updated Policy pieces.
So, Judey; what do you want?
I'll tell you what I want, what I really really want: targeted communication to Vocal creator/writers.
This is NOT new.
Five years ago, the eleventh thing I posted on Vocal was about communicating to Vocal writers when things aren't working correctly.
Five years ago, BEFORE leaving Comments on Articles as a Thing, all of the stats stopped updating. No number of Hearts given. No number of Reads showing, no increase in Earnings.
Back then we had Facebook groups as the means to communicate, writer-to-writer. Trust me: those screens blew UP. What is happening? Will we still need to pay for this month? Should I even try to post? (Also- back then posts could take days, a week was normal, even longer during a Challenge.)
So I wrote about how a group/company should prepare to distribute information when a Situation Develops. (It's a good piece; 4 steps, it's solid)
At the end of the piece I gently shared that Vocal had an opportunity to do this in their current situation. (I was, perhaps, a kinder and more gentle folk when I was in my 50's?)
Now, though? Now two emails the day of and the day after a rest is not enough. It is, indeed, a start, but it isn't enough.
I certainly did not expect a rest to be obstacle-free. That is not how platform remakes happen. There are bumps and outages. Things happen. Stuff breaks. Connections don't, well, always connect.
I get it. We get it.
User Experience isn't just people that read what we create. User Experience includes what happens when the Creators try to Create.
You have our email addresses; please use them.
